The House of Blues on Fifth is home for live music and Southern inspired cuisine. Their one-of-a-kind menu features traditional Southern favorites such as Creole Jambalaya with enticing dishes like Pan-Seared Voodoo Shrimp & Mediterranean Style Calamari.
